To use DotNetBar 14.1.0.0 in a project, developers typically reference the DevComponents.DotNetBar2.dll . Once added to the Visual Studio toolbox, these controls can be dragged onto a form just like standard WinForms elements. devcomponents dotnetbar 14100 with source code

stands as a landmark release in the evolution of Windows Forms (WinForms) development. For over a decade, this suite has been a staple for developers aiming to bridge the gap between standard, utilitarian gray-box interfaces and the high-fidelity aesthetics seen in modern productivity software.
